Understanding Sustainability in Education
Sustainability in education encompasses the integration of ecological principles into learning environments. It involves teaching students about environmental stewardship, social responsibility, and economic viability. More than just academic lessons, it encourages students to think critically about their impact on the world and to develop solutions to pressing global challenges.
Pavna’s Commitment to Green Initiatives
At PAVNA International School, a commitment to sustainability underlines the school’s ethos. The school understands that fostering a culture of sustainability not only contributes to environmental well-being but also aids in building responsible, informed citizens of the future. Here are some of the key green initiatives undertaken by the school:
1. Eco-Friendly Infrastructure
PAVNA International School features buildings designed with sustainable architecture principles. This includes energy-efficient systems, rainwater harvesting, and natural lighting to reduce electricity consumption. By using local and eco-friendly materials for construction, the school has minimized its carbon footprint from the outset.
2. Waste Reduction Programs
The school has implemented robust waste management programs that include recycling and composting. Students are educated about the importance of reducing, reusing, and recycling waste. Engaging in hands-on activities like composting organic waste from the cafeteria helps students understand the concept of circular economy.
3. Green Curriculum
PAVNA International School incorporates sustainability into its Cambridge curriculum. Subjects like science and geography include modules on environmental science, climate change, and conservation efforts. This not only informs students about global issues but also empowers them to think about solutions and innovations that can make a difference.
4. Green Spaces and Biodiversity
The school invests in creating green spaces on campus. Gardens, tree plantations, and natural habitats encourage biodiversity and provide a living laboratory for students to learn about ecosystems. This immersive experience fosters a deeper appreciation for nature and the importance of protecting it.
5. Community Engagement and Awareness
PAVNA International School believes that education extends beyond its walls. The school actively engages with the local community by organizing clean-up drives, tree planting initiatives, and sustainability workshops. These activities encourage students to be ambassadors for sustainability in their communities, promoting eco-conscious practices in everyday life.
6. Energy Conservation Initiatives
The school has adopted several energy conservation measures, such as using solar panels and energy-efficient appliances. Students are trained to be mindful of energy usage and are encouraged to adopt practices that conserve energy both in school and at home.
